A masterclass in luxurious design & decor, this beautifully converted, split level three bedroom period apartment is just moments from Wanstead High Street. Brimming with sumptuous designer touches, you have a vast shared garden to the rear.

The bustling heart of this ever-popular East London village, Wanstead High Street is home to a charming range of independent cafes, gastropubs and stores, all flanked by open green space and just moments from your front door.

IF YOU LIVED HERE…

You'll be enjoying an impressive suite of luxury spaces behind that striking facade. Step inside and your colossal reception is on your left. A vast 270 square foot, passionately restored original timber floorboards gleam underfoot, light flows in from the large, raised bay window and a smart pewter hearth sits in the chimney breast. It's a beautiful hosting space and a superb introduction.

Explore further down the hall for your principal bedroom, 150 square feet with whitewashed original timber underfoot, direct garden access and a dedicated dressing room. Bedroom two, currently in use as a study, has still more integrated storage while your family bathroom is an artful affair with freestanding tub, corner rainfall shower cubicle and shiny slate underfoot.

Your kitchen/diner's smartly decked out with glossy cabinetry and a breakfast bar with glorious garden views. Step out here for your vast, 180 foot long shared garden flanked by fencing and screening greenery and with nothing but mature trees on the horizon. Downstairs your lovingly developed basement consists of a third potential bedroom (currently in use as a home cinema), a gleaming, fresh utility room (practically a second kitchen) and a sixty square foot storage room, ideal for further development.

WHAT ELSE?

- Snaresbrook tube station, sat in zone three for the central line, is just five minutes on foot and will get you directly to Liverpool Street (sixteen minutes) or Tottenham Court Road (twenty five minutes) for speedy door-to-door access to the City and West End.
- Wanstead High Street is packed with culinary highlights, but be sure to sample the homemade treats at The Larder. Delicious.
- The tranquil blue waters of Eagle Pond are less than ten minutes walk, with the endlessly explorable greenery of Epping Forest just beyond. Great for morning jogs, evening strolls or anytime you want to blow away the cobwebs.

Thanks to its royal connections and grand properties, Wanstead has previously been compared to the likes of Twickenham and Richmond, although East Londoners are quick to point out that it has plenty enough merits of its own. 

For a start, despite its villagey feel, it’s proudly nestled within London’s most creative quadrant and only a short hop on the Central line from the bright lights of the City. There’s also an abundance of green space – Wanstead Flats, Epping Forest, Wanstead Park and Chalet Wood, with the seasonal display of bluebells in the latter just calling out for an accompanying picnic from one of the well-stocked local delis or cafes. But that’s not to say that Wanstead’s charming pubs and restaurants aren’t delightful to look at themselves – it’ll be deciding which to go for that’s the problem.
